Roland LAPC-I

Roland's Coolest Internal Synth Card

The Roland LAPC-I (Linear Arithmatic Personal Computer IBM or ISA) was an internal expansion card for the ISA bus. The LAPC-I was effectively an MT-32, CM-32L (including its 33 extra sound effects waveforms) and a true MPU-401 MIDI interface all contained on one long ISA card. Read more about Roland LAPC-I

Roland GS to MT-32 Conversion Utility

This is a set of MIDI files that can be used to make a Roland GS device emulate an Roland MT-32 (some better than others). This is similar to the MT-32 to GM MIDI files, only this is GS to MT-32. The Roland GS device in question must contain the original Roland MT-32 tones in order for this to work. There is also a MIDI file to reset the device back to the standard Roland GS settings. This file is a self-extracting Pkzip file.

FYI: Roland GS stands for Roland General Standard, that's an inspiring acronym... Read more about Roland GS to MT-32 Conversion Utility

Roland MT-32 General MIDI Conversion Utility

Roland MT-32 to GM General MIDI Conversion MIDI Files

The Roland MT-32 was developed and sold well before the time of General MIDI. This is a set of MIDI files to set the Roland MT-32 and MT-32 compatible modules to patch sets that more closely emulate the General MIDI specification. There are a few MIDI files included here that only work with the CM-32L, CM-64 and the LAPC-I. There is also a set of MIDI files to set the Roland "D" series synths (D-5, D-10, D-50 and so on) into GM mode. This is a self-extracting DOS Pkzip file.
